Sometimes I get a loud noise when I change gear, like a fairly high pitched whiring, along the same sort of speed as the general drivetrain noise but alot louder. It seems to do it if I dont take my foot of the clutch quick enough when changing gear. I can also get it to do it, if I drive along in second gear at around 4000 revs and press the clutch around half way down.

Is the bright switch supposed to change the whole dash or just the clock? :-)

Forgot to put my cars year I have a 99 Rb5 with PPP
